Job Description

At Houston Methodist, the Athletic Trainer PRN position is responsible for preventing, recognizing, assessing, managing, treating, disposing of, and reconditioning athletic injuries under the direction of a physician licensed in this state or another qualified, licensed health professional. This position performs related duties in accordance with the state practice act, applicable regulations, and department policy, procedures, and practices. The Athletic Trainer PRN position demonstrates competence to adapt to work and customer service to accommodate the unique physical, psychosocial, cultural, safety and other development needs of patients served by the department.

SERVICE ESSENTIAL FUNCTIONS
  • Practices prevention, recognition, assessment, management, treatment, and reconditioning of injuries in accordance with athletic training practice act and in collaboration with providers.
  • Documents patient assessments and treatment notes accurately.
  • Works in an integrated manner with the health team in the provision of exercise and treatment modalities.
QUALITY/SAFETY ESSENTIAL FUNCTIONS
  • Provides safe, effective athletic training appropriate to the patient's ability and injury based upon the relevant evidence-based practice.
  • Prepares patients for practice and competition through the appropriate utilization of braces, bandages, wrapping and taping techniques to prevent injury. Provides emergency care within the athletic trainer scope of practice.
  • Proactively identifies/assesses any facility, environment, or patient related issues, documenting and communicating to management as appropriate. Corrects minor safety hazards.

Qualifications:

EDUCATION

  • Bachelor's degree
WORK EXPERIENCE
  • None needed
LICENSES AND CERTIFICATIONS - REQUIRED
  • AT - Certified Athletic Trainer - State Licensure OR
  • AT-Temp - Certified Athletic Trainer - Temporary State Licensure AND
  • BLS - Basic Life Support (AHA)
